Katherine J. Schafer is a scholar working on Biomedical Engineering, Materials Chemistry and Physical and Theoretical Chemistry. According to data from OpenAlex, Katherine J. Schafer has authored 24 papers receiving a total of 1.3k indexed citations (citations by other indexed papers that have themselves been cited), including 20 papers in Biomedical Engineering, 19 papers in Materials Chemistry and 8 papers in Physical and Theoretical Chemistry. Recurrent topics in Katherine J. Schafer’s work include Nonlinear Optical Materials Studies (19 papers), Photochromic and Fluorescence Chemistry (12 papers) and Photochemistry and Electron Transfer Studies (8 papers). Katherine J. Schafer is often cited by papers focused on Nonlinear Optical Materials Studies (19 papers), Photochromic and Fluorescence Chemistry (12 papers) and Photochemistry and Electron Transfer Studies (8 papers). Katherine J. Schafer collaborates with scholars based in United States and Ukraine. Katherine J. Schafer's co-authors include Kevin D. Belfield, Olga V. Przhonska, Mykhailo V. Bondar, Eric W. Van Stryland and David J. Hagan and has published in prestigious journals such as The Journal of Chemical Physics, Chemistry of Materials and The Journal of Organic Chemistry.
